Employee Health and Workers’ Compensation

As a responsible employer, you need to ensure that the workspace you provide to your employees is safe and secure. This insurance will provide coverage in the event when an employee gets injured at the workplace. No matter what safety measures you take to avoid these accidents and injuries, you can never guarantee that nobody will get injured. 

Apart from workers’ compensation, you should also provide employee health insurance. Although they may sound similar, they are different. Workers’ compensation covers medical expenses for temporary, permanent injuries, death of an employee due to an accident. On the other hand, employee health insurance comes under employee benefits that cover their medical bills when they fall sick.

Professional Liability Insurance

Professional liability insurance protects your business from lawsuits filed against the negligence of your professional services. It’s also known as the error and omission insurance that covers the losses due to negligence claims due to errors or mistakes in your services. 

Professional liability insurance is suitable for those who provide professional services. Anyway, other businesses can also have this type of insurance. However, you need to choose the right policy that suits your unique business needs and size. There is no one-size-fits-all policy; you should ensure that it covers the potential losses. 

Product Liability Insurance

Like professional liability insurance for services, you need product liability insurance if you are manufacturing a product. Although you might have taken all the essential steps and measure that your product is safe. However, that does not guarantee that nobody will file a lawsuit against your product. 

Therefore, it’s crucial to have product liability insurance that will cover your losses when someone files a lawsuit against your product. If your business doesn’t have product liability insurance, it will also act as evidence that your product was not safe. 

Vehicle Insurance

Businesses with commercial vehicles (whether it’s car or truck) need to have insurance for the vehicles. Although accidents are uncertain and unfortunate, your losses will not be covered if you don’t have vehicle insurance. 

Apart from vehicle insurance, you need to have employee insurance and personal insurance to protect you and your employees due to the accident. Even though vehicle insurance will cover the damage to your vehicle, it will not cover your health insurance. You need to have separate insurance for your employees and yourself.

Business Interruption Insurance

As the name suggests, this type of insurance covers when you suffer from financial loss due to interruption in your business. The reason for the interruption in your business can be anything from a disaster like fire or storm to or legal dispute. 

Your business may be interrupted during this time due to hindrance in production, sales, or any other business operation. So, business interruption insurance compensates for your loss during this event and moves forward. Usually, this insurance is suitable for businesses that need a physical store or space.
